Honestly, I know this will go against the grain of the regulars around here, but I am more prone to buy clothing that is made of certain materials/designs than I am to buy for a particular pattern. I really like waterproof fleece for my outer layer, it is silent and keeps the wind and water off me when it is nasty out. I honestly don't really have problems getting sighted and picked offin my tree or in a blind, and haven't for probably 5-6 years now. I do get winded occasionally, but not often becauseI am careful of my stand placement. This is why I haven't yet sprung for something of a more open pattern like predator/asat or the new enigma. This is not to say that these camo's don't work better (i think they probably do wor much better) but I really don't seem to have problems with the realtree hd hardwoods grey I have now. I may be getting an enigma suite this fall though, because I hope to have them in the shop for customers and I would like to give the setup a shot to see how they work. I think the real advantage to this type of camo is when I have a spot that doesn't have a tree that can break up my outline once the leaves have dropped it will probably keep me from getting spotted and skylined a bit better. For now I simply don't hunt out of trees that won't break my outline up and keep me concealed............maybe this new camo will allow me more freedom when picking "the perfect tree".
